Ticket: Config drift on timing-chip readers — Course B

During the Brindlewood Marathon dry run, readers on Course B reported split times roughly 40 ms behind Course A. Investigation showed the Course B units were still running last season's antenna gain and poll-interval settings — someone updated them by hand instead of through Chronopost, our config pusher. New team members, please note: reader settings must never be edited on-device. For reference, the canonical Course A readers currently run with these values.

deployment values, yafop-tahof:
HOLIX_HOST=holix.zemvarsys.internal
HOLIX_PORT=3306

To: Dispatch Desk
Subject: Drone unit returned for servicing

Please note that survey drone unit "Kestrel-4" has been returned from the Marrow Field site and is boxed, battery removed, in bay C. It must go to Veltran Robotics for its scheduled overhaul; the service form is taped to the lid. Handle the gimbal side up at all times. At hand-over, give the courier this exact instruction:

dispatch memo: the eliath belael courier leaves the praox ledger at gate 8841 under passcode 017589

**Q: Where has the mail room moved to?**

As part of the refurbishment at Tollard Point, the mail room has relocated from the ground floor to room 1.14 on the first floor, beside the goods lift. Visiting contractors collecting or dropping off parcels should sign in at the front desk first, then proceed upstairs. The new mail room door is kept locked outside staffed hours, so you will need the access code, provided below:

door code, yagap-bahof: bdg-O-05